作为一个编程初学者,应当先学c语言或者是python?又或者是其它语言?

如题所述

我认为,这个因人而异:
有的人适用先学python,这样精力主要集中在实际应用中(用程序来解决问题),不需要花费很多精力在语言本身上。可谓时间短见效快。
而有的人,没那么着急和功利,有大把时间,并且希望自底向上,先把基础功搞扎实,以便将来走得更远。
我说说自己的体会:
我自己上学那会,只学C、C++,工作初也有几年时间只使用C/C++。对C/C++算是比较熟悉了。
公司没变,但后来业务的需要逐渐改为使用python语言,但此时我然忽然发现,得益于前面对C/c++的熟悉,学习python易如反掌,对于python中的各种现象也觉得非常好理解(自动能想象其底层设计和实现,也能很好理解为何它会这样设计)。
总之,我认为,有了c/c++的基础,其它高级语言学习起来根本不费力。
当然,看你学习的目的和用途,如果只是打算学门语言用来解决问题,先从python入门也不是什么坏事。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-02-15
一看这个问题,我会毫无疑问的回答c语言。
不过,仔细思考一下还是这样回答你吧,如果,你只是想玩儿一玩儿,体验一下编程,那你学python,容易上手,没有概念加入,还有很多优质的库。
如果,你想深入学习,或者想在计算机专业方面走得更远,c语言很有必要学习。对形成计算机思维很有帮助。追问

那么请问如果把c学的深入了,再学会不会很容易呢?

追答

会有很大的帮助。这么说吧c语言没有绚丽的功能,但是一门基础的语言,通过c语言对程序设计会有一个系统的了解,更多的是理念上的适应。

追问

说掉了,先学会c,在学Python会不会很容易?

追答

真学会了c,你会发现,万物基于c语言

你说的是的

追问

好的,谢谢你啦

我准备学习c,那么学c要准备什么书或者电脑需要下载什么软件?

追答

谭浩强 c语言教程

追问

好的谢谢😄,麻烦您了

追答

编程软件就用dev c++吧,祝你好运。

本回答被提问者采纳
第2个回答  2020-02-21
2中种语言的应用领域不同:
C语言偏向硬件,比如智能小汽车,飞行器等等。
python则是上位机语言,可以做电脑软件,网页等等()
要说前途:python是更容易上手,工资普遍也比较高。
C语言则是看能力,工资低的就是七八千,工资高的高到离谱,但是花的学习时间非常多,而且要吃青春饭(对于高工资的那部分人群)。
个人总结(错误勿喷):
python上手简单,易学,纯软件,吃工作量
C语言针对硬件,需要懂硬件电路,调试麻烦,需要聪明,活到老学到老。
至于什么学c语言有助于python,的确如此,但是如果想学python,个人不建议先学C,可能会形成惯性思维,不利于对python的记忆,容易混淆。建议可以先学python,会用了后,如果想加深理解再学C有助于编程思路。
第3个回答  2020-02-27
c语言比较复杂难学,且在现实中非计算机行业用到的很少。python简单易学,学完后就可以应用,比如处理数据,不再用excel,而直接用python。
第4个回答  2020-02-17

我推荐PYTHON,我也在学,我个人觉得相当好学,我现在学PYTHON人智能,我用的是APTANA

相似回答